Visa information

If you are traveling on a Laos passport, you have three primary ways to secure your entry into Vietnam.

1. The E-Visa (Recommended)

The most convenient and popular choice for tourism and short business trips.

- Best for: Most travelers.

- Validity: Up to 90 days (Single or Multiple Entry).

- Entry Points: Valid at 83 international airports, land borders, and seaports.

- Process: Applied for and issued entirely online through the official government portal (evisa.gov.vn).

2. Visa on Arrival (VOA)

A secondary option specifically for those flying from Laos to Vietnam who may have unique requirements.

- Best for: Last-minute travelers or those with specific visa types not covered by e-visas.

- Cons: Air travel only. You cannot use this for land or sea crossings.

- Requirements: You must obtain a "Visa Approval Letter" from a travel agency before you board your flight. You will then get the actual visa stamp at the airport upon arrival.

3. Embassy Visa

The traditional route via the Vietnamese Embassy in Vientiane.

- Best for: Travelers who prefer having a sticker visa in their passport before leaving home, or those seeking longer-term/specialized visas.

- Flexibility: Generally valid for entry via air, land, or sea.

- Process: Requires submitting your physical passport and application directly to the embassy. Please check the embassy website for more information: https://vnembassy-vientiane.mofa.gov.vn/en-us/

- Quick Comparison Table

Feature E-Visa Visa on Arrival Embassy Visa
Effort Low (Online) Medium (Pre-letter + Queue) High (In-person/Post)
Cost Usually cheapest Varies (Letter + Stamping fee) Varies
Entry Port Air, Land, & Sea Air Only Air, Land, & Sea
Processing 3–5 working days 2–4 working days (for letter) Varies

Local tip: Always make sure your Laos passport has at least 6 months of validity remaining from your intended date of entry into Vietnam to avoid being denied boarding.
